**Ticket #—: SchemaLoft vault locked again**

Hey — the vault holding signing keys for SchemaLoft (our event schema registry) locked itself after three failed unlock attempts during last night's release. Can't publish the v12 payment-event schema until it's open. Rather than paging half the team, I'm dropping the recovery passphrase here so you can unseal it yourself.

unlock words, fahop-yageg: ralwyn-kelath

# reminderd — appointment reminder job for the Maplehollow Clinic suite
# Runs nightly at 02:00 local clinic time; sends SMS and email reminders
# for appointments in the next 48 hours. New team members: use the
# sandbox patient dataset locally, never a production export.
# DRY_RUN=true is mandatory outside production — real sends require
# sign-off from the on-call lead. Batch size stays at 150 to avoid
# gateway throttling. The messaging gateway secret goes on the next line.

sealed setting: VAULT_KEY20=69e2a0b23f1a79fbf692

Ticket VELD-usual: The EXIF scrubbing pipeline in Photomarsh halted because its credentials vault locked after repeated auth failures from the worker fleet. Images are queuing unscrubbed, so do not release any batches until the vault is reopened. On-call should unseal it from the operator console using the standard recovery flow. The passphrase required by that flow is recorded immediately below this line.

vault phrase of bagaf-kajeg = jorath-feniel-briir-siliel-ralix

WaveTrace preview renders flat lines for clips under 400ms. Downsampler divides by zero when the frame window exceeds sample count. Fix clamps window size to buffer length; added regression test with a 120ms fixture. No change to the export path. Repro only on the Pellicut staging tier so far. Reviewer: verify against the build tagged with the token below.

session token of bawep-yadup = htk21_528abd376e3c5a4ec24a1